I just returned from Gran Canaria, the third islands I've visited on the archipelago. You might have seen some of my posts about Tenerife and Lanzarote and how much I love those islands.
Gran Canaria actually is a bit harder to love. Before showing you the nice sides of the island, let me share with you some pictures of the worst 'Calima' in 40 years. La Calima is a phenomenon when Sahara sand is blown over from the African continent. Visibility is reduced several hundred meters, you're advised not to go out without protecting your face as breathing the tiny particles might cause respiratory problems. Airports all over the Canary islands were closed, it was quite an event.
On the bright side, however, it made for some pretty awesome pictures. Las Palmas, the capital, was swept empty of people like in an apocalypse movie. Take a look:
